Increasing Success

Keith Pillow and David Grech of Duplex Real Estate Branding meet with the Economic Update’s David Clancy to discuss this year’s HSBC Malta Property Expo and the successes of 2009.

Last year’s Property Expo proved a huge success for Duplex who established themselves in 2004, but they also identified areas where they could improve on the event. “Last year we carried out surveys with our attendees so that we could further improve the expo and make the event itself as much of a hit as possible,” explains Mr Pillow, CEO of Duplex. “We aim to create a one-stop shop window for the property market in Malta to help bring the Maltese market to an international stage.”

Coming in second place as the best property fair in Europe in its first year is testament to the success of the expo. “We were ecstatic to have been awarded second place, and when you lose out to such an established company as A Place in the Sun, there is no shame at all,” states Mr Grech, Events and Business Development Coordinator.

“We were fortunate to have been launching our exhibition in a time when a lot of other nations were seeing a much greater recession in their markets,” adds Mr Pillow. “Malta as a whole has been very fortunate in comparison over these unsteady times.”

But this takes nothing away from the achievements of the 2009 Property Expo. This year, seems to be heading for even greater heights as Mr Grech explains to me that more than 90 per cent of the allocated space has already been booked by exhibitors and businesses, when this time last year they had achieved the still respectable 50 per cent. This shows the escalation of the expo itself within the market as prospective buyers and developers see it as an able launching platform for their projects.

“We already have five large developments launching new faces within their projects at our expo,” explains Mr Pillow. “Where usually they would host a gala for such announcements, they are now seeing our expo as a formidable platform for this.”

Amongst the many exhibitors attending the 2010 Property Expo will be a government presence promoting various authorities working within the industry, with a variety of stands designated solely to the government industries such as MEPA.

One of the main changes from last year is going to be the importance that is placed on exhibiting to first-time buyers, with banks presenting special offers and incentives. “The major banks of the island will be there to help provide first-time buyers with information to prepare them in entering the complexities and pitfalls of the property market, ensuring that they make the best decisions for their future.”

“We’re very happy to have had the trust of HSBC from the very beginning,” states Mr Pillow. “It gives us great confidence to have such an internationally known brand backing us all the way.”

Duplex are also currently building an entire apartment to exhibit the importance of interior design. “It used to be that property was sold on the basis of ‘bricks and mortar’ but now it is increasingly important to show properties as homes.”

The company is very proud of a scheme set up by them which has now become part of the curriculum for third year students at university in which they are asked to design an environmentally friendly and efficient building of any type. “This gives the students the opportunity to present their ideas and work with professionals working within the industry today.”

The company is certainly a buzz with excitement for the coming expo in March, which is shaping up to be more successful than the last.
